Eratosthenes of cyrene, employing mathematical theories and geometrical methods, discovered from the course of the sun, the shadows cast by an equinoctial gnomon, and the inclination of the heaven that the circumference of the earth is two hundred and fiftytwo thousand stadia, that is, thirtyone million five hundred thousand paces.
